Abstract :
This paper reviews analytical models and software for sound propagation modelling and prediction, including room acoustics and outdoor sound propagation, and current instrumentation for sound measurement. Based on the review of the state-of-the-art for acoustic modelling and sound measurement instrumentation, emerging challenges are discussed. Finally, the paper proposes new instrument development using 3D sound-field sensor arrays and 1D/2D acoustic sensor arrays incorporated with sensor networks for soundscape investigation and further applications.
